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_020792.6(NCEH1):​c.1184G>C​(p.Arg395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,810 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R395Q) has been classified as Uncertain significance.

Genes affected
NCEH1 (HGNC:29260): (neutral cholesterol ester hydrolase 1) Predicted to enable hydrolase activity. Predicted to be involved in ether lipid metabolic process. Predicted to act upstream of or within SMAD protein signal transduction; protein dephosphorylation; and xenobiotic metabolic process. Located in membrane.
